Wythenshawe Roots and Academy Ascent

Born in Wythenshawe, Manchester, Marcus Rashford joined the Manchester United academy system at the age of seven. His prodigious talent was evident from an early age, as he progressed through the famed youth setup that has produced so many legends. The legacy of The Manchester United Academy: Producing Legends from the Class of '92 to Today provided both inspiration and a daunting benchmark. Rashford’s development was closely monitored, with his pace, direct dribbling, and cool finishing marking him as a special prospect. A Fairytale Debut and Instant Impact

Rashford’s moment arrived not from a planned unveiling, but from an injury crisis. In February 2016, with United short on attackers ahead of a UEFA Europa League tie against Midtjylland, the 18-year-old was thrust into the starting lineup. What followed was the stuff of dreams: a brace on his debut. He repeated the feat just three days later on his Premier League debut against Arsenal, announcing himself to the world with a stunning, decisive performance. Overnight, Rashford became a sensation. His fearless style and clinical edge offered a burst of excitement during a period of transition for the club, proving the academy's pipeline remained potent.

Establishing Himself as a United and England Stalwart

The years that followed saw Rashford transition from a surprise package to a cornerstone of the team. He showcased his versatility, playing on either wing or through the middle. Key contributions became his hallmark:

  • Derby Day Heroics: Scoring winners against Manchester City, etching his name into derby folklore.
  • Wembley Magic: Scoring in major finals, including the 2017 EFL Cup and Europa League triumphs.
  • England Breakthrough: Carrying his club form onto the international stage, he scored minutes into his England debut and was a key figure in the runs to the 2018 World Cup semi-final and the Euro 2020 final.
  • Milestone Goals: Joining an elite group of players to score for Manchester United in their teens, 20s, and 30s, and reaching over 100 goals for the club.

More Than a Footballer: Advocacy and Influence

Perhaps what truly distinguishes Rashford's career is his profound impact off the pitch. During the COVID-19 pandemic, he campaigned tirelessly to end child food poverty in the UK, successfully persuading the government to extend free school meal provisions. His advocacy earned him widespread acclaim, including an MBE from the Queen. He used his platform to address social inequality, becoming a role model far beyond the football pitch. Overcoming Adversity and Looking Ahead

Rashford's journey has not been without challenges. He has experienced dips in form, managerial changes, and the intense scrutiny that comes with being Manchester United's homegrown star. A difficult 2021-22 season was followed by a spectacular resurgence in 2022-23 under Erik ten Hag, where he scored 30 goals, rediscovering his explosive best and proving his mental resilience. This ability to bounce back is a testament to his character. As United builds for the future, Rashford remains a pivotal figure.
